A lot of plants succeed under a series of dirt conditions, nonetheless many plants have an optimal pH variety, salt resistance degree, and dirt dampness need. In selecting plants for Utah, keep in mind that a lot of dirts have an alkaline (high) pH and some have modest to high salt degrees. The most fundamental part of your landscape is the dirt and numerous landscape issues can be stayed clear of if an appropriate amount of time is spent on effectively preparing the soil prior to the landscape is mounted.
Using plant types that are adapted to the soil will certainly help reduce maintenance and water called for. 2 major concerns are appropriate depth of topsoil and the high quality of topsoil. A depth of 8-12" is optimal and will solve numerous problems in the future. Plant growth and convenience of upkeep are enhanced tremendously by top quality dirts.
To change dirts properly requires an understanding of the complying with features. This refers to the percents of sand, silt, and clay in a dirt. Sandy soils drain swiftly and keep little water or nutrients. Clay soils consist of a lot smaller fragments and have much less drain, but much better nutrient retention than sandy soils.
Loam dirts, or close loved ones such as clay loams or silt loams, are the most effective soils for plant development. Framework describes the degree to which tiny soil particles glob with each other, developing both huge and small pores throughout the dirt. This clumping aids water and air motion in the soil since water and air can move freely with the huge pores.
Organic issue is advantageous in soil due to the fact that it breaks down to give plant nutrients. Organic issue also improves water infiltration, drainage and retention in the soil, largely due to its capacity to boost soil framework.
It is essential because the soil pH affects the availability of mineral nutrients to plants. Due to the high pH of these dirts, the iron existing is not conveniently offered for plant development.

Lawns have several benefits consisting of cooling impacts, disintegration control, water filtration and water infiltration. Yards can stand up to trampling and play that no other plant can deal with.
With mindful selection and effective watering, lawns can be a vital component of the low-water landscape. Of the 7 leading concepts of water-wise landscape design (a.k.a. Xeriscaping), the most debatable includes the usage of turfgrass in the landscape.
Buffalo lawn (right) is a good lawn option for Intermountain landscapes. The reason that turfgrass is pointed out especially in water-wise landscaping guidelines is that there is fantastic potential for over-irrigation of turfgrasses. Unlike various other plants that show the stresses of over-watering easily, turfgrass has the ability to withstand a large amount of over-irrigation without showing indicators of stress.
These truths combined with a "more is always much better" attitude towards landscape watering, incline turfgrass locations to over-irrigation. Turfgrass has some very specific benefits in the landscape. It is the only landscape plant product that can stand up to the stresses of traffic and mowing that are frequently applied to it.
And mowed grass are a basic element of several urban fire control strategies. Turfgrass likewise supplies many various other environmental advantages. One such benefit is a reduction in the amount of surface area drainage water. This is a vital component to safeguarding water quality. A typical fairway, for example, can take in 4 million gallons of water throughout a 1-inch rainstorm.

In truth, mulching around trees, shrubs, and in flower beds can cause a ten-fold decrease in evaporative water loss from soil.
With fewer weeds, less growing is called for, which can protect against damages to plant origins, soil structure, and soil microorganisms. In enhancement, mulch moderates soil temperature level and safeguards plant origins.
Organic mulches consist of products such as wood or bark chips, shredded bark, nut coverings, want needles, or various other discarded plant components. These products have the possible to boost soil framework, boost dirt fertility, avoid compaction, and rise dirt raw material as they break down and are integrated right into the soil.
To make certain appropriate water seepage and oygenation and to slow disintegration, see to it compost fragments are bigger than the underlying dirt particles (usually bigger than a fifty percent inch in size). Recycled plant products have to be totally free from weed seeds, disease-causing organisms, and pesticide and herbicide deposits. You can either make use of disease-free plant components that have actually not been chemically treated, or you can compost your compost before usage.
Nitrogen loss can be stayed clear of by utilizing composted compost or by adding nitrogen at a rate of 1-2 lbs real N per 1000 ft2. With time, organic mulches damage down and will certainly require to be replenished. Replenishment can be accomplished simply by including more compost over the top of the disintegrated compost product.

In enhancement to preserving water, correct watering can urge deeper root growth and healthier, a lot more drought tolerant landscapes. An important element of water-efficient landscaping is producing hydrozones for your irrigation needs. To offer appropriate water to all plants without over or under-watering some, group plants with comparable irrigation needs in one area.
One more vital facet of irrigation planning includes routine maintenance of the system. Monthly evaluation of the watering system, while in operation, will certainly aid you to find and repair any busted, misaligned, or blocked sprinkler heads and keep your system running successfully. Drip Irrigation systems contains plastic pipes with emitters that supply water straight to plants.
Strategy and design watering systems to make sure that turfgrass locations are irrigated separately from various other landscape plants. There are numerous sources available to determine the ideal watering schedule for turf areas in Utah. from the Utah Department of Water Resources from the Utah Department of Water Resources Trees and bushes have much deeper and much more considerable origin systems than turfgrass so they need to be sprinkled much less often however, for longer durations of time.
The amount of water to use in any type of circumstance depends on the dirt type. Sandy dirts soak up water the fastest (regarding 2" per hour), followed by loam dirts (3/4" per hour).
By allowing water to pass through much deeper right into the soil profile, you are urging deeper rooting and an even more drought forgiving plant. Frequent, light watering will result in plants that have a superficial origin system and that are much more prone to water stress and anxiety.
